이 가이드는 검색 중재 제공업체인 System1을 위한 것입니다. 그들의 문서는 여기에서 확인할 수 있습니다.
일반적으로 검색 중재 추적은 키워드와 다양한 필수 데이터 매개변수의 존재로 인해 매우 까다로울 수 있습니다.
System1은 더 복잡한 데이터 전달 구성 중 하나를 가지고 있습니다. 그들은 포스트백에서 발생시키는 ID를 전달하는 대신, 호출할 미리 계산된 URL 문자열을 전달하기를 기대합니다.
따라서 click_id=xxx
와 같은 것을 전달하는 대신, postback_to_fire=https%3A%2F%2Fmydomain.com%2Fpb%3Fhit%3Dxxx
와 같은 것을 전달하기를 기대합니다.
이미 혼란스러우신가요? 아래 가이드를 따라 데이터 전달 설정에 주의를 기울이세요.
System1 오퍼 소스 생성하기
먼저, 새로운 오퍼 소스를 생성하고 System1 템플릿을 사용하세요.
데이터 전달 섹션을 주목하세요:
여기에는 매우 중요한 고려사항들이 있습니다:
- 우리는
{data-xxx}
토큰을 사용하여 compkey와 rskey를 전달하고 있습니다. 이는 값들이 트래픽 소스로부터 사용하는 링크를 통해 올 것이라는 의미입니다 -- 따라서 트래픽 소스에ad_title
과keyword
에 해당하는 URL 추적 필드가 있고, 이들이 항상 System1에 적절한 값을 전달하는 것이 중요합니다. - 우리는
click_track_url
아래에 포스트백 URL을 전달하고 있습니다 - 이는 나중에 System1에 의해 발생될 것입니다 - 우리는
search_track_url
아래에 또 다른 URL, 이 경우 액션 링크를 전달하고 있습니다 - 이는 완전히 선택사항이며 우리의 퍼널에 더미 랜더를 추가해야 합니다. 이를 통해 검색 중재 페이지에서 CTR을 시뮬레이션할 수 있지만 특별히 필요하지는 않습니다. 결국 검색 중재에서는 뷰 > 전환의 비율이 높기 때문에 중간 클릭은 그렇게 중요하지 않습니다. 이를 추가할지 말지는 여러분의 선택입니다. 추가한다면, 초기 CTR 추적에 대한 후반부 섹션을 참조하세요. - 위의 특정 문자열은
https://{tracking-domain}/action/1?vid={visitor}&rn={current-node-id}
입니다
우리가 미리 계산된 URL을 System1에 전달하기 때문에, 전환 추적 탭에서 할 일이 없으며, System1 측에서 설정할 포스트백도 없습니다.
사용된 트래픽 소스 구성하기
앞서 언급했듯이, 트래픽 소스에서 사용자 지정 데이터(광고 제목 및 키워드)를 전달해야 하며, 이 값들이 System1에 전달됩니다.
앞선 그림을 확인하세요 -- 우리는 {data-ad_title}
과 {data-keyword}
토큰을 사용합니다.
따라서, System1을 통한 검색 중재 전용의 새로운 트래픽 소스를 만드는 것을 추천합니다. 예를 들어 TikTok (System1)입니다. 적절한 템플릿을 사용한 다음 매개변수를 추가하거나 조정할 수 있습니다. TikTok 템플릿을 예로 들면:
여기서 ad_title
을 추가하고 REPLACE로 설정했으며, keyword
추적 필드도 추가하고 값을 REPLACE로 설정했습니다.
TikTok에는 광고 제목/키워드가 없기 때문에, 적절한 제목 매개변수를 전달하기 위해 URL에서 이를 수동으로 대체해야 합니다.
Taboola의 다른 예를 들어보겠습니다:
여기서 Taboola는 제목에 대한 데이터 전달이 있으므로 그대로 사용할 수 있습니다. 그러나 다시 키워드가 없으므로 새로운 keyword
필드를 추가하고 값을 REPLACE로 설정해야 합니다.
여기서의 목표는 광고 URL을 생성하고 해당 URL에서 REPLACE --> 다른 것으로 데이터를 변경하는 것입니다. 그러나 아래와 같이 나중에 오퍼 수준에서도 이를 재정의할 수 있습니다.
오퍼에 키워드 데이터 전달하기
System1 오퍼의 경우, 오퍼를 생성한 다음 중재 도메인을 기본 페이지 URL로 사용하게 됩니다. URL 구조의 나머지 부분은 데이터 전달 섹션에서 처리됩니다.
실행하는 각 광고에 대해 광고 제목과 키워드 값을 전달하게 됩니다. 이러한 광고 제목/키워드 값을 변경하는 두 가지 방법이 있습니다.
옵션 1: 트래픽 소스에서 URL로 전달
이는 위에서 사용하고 있는 구성입니다.
이를 통해 오퍼는 단일 오퍼(검색 중재 도메인 URL)가 되고 다른 광고를 생성하게 됩니다 --> 이는 다른 값을 전달할 수 있고 --> 다른 검색 중재 페이지 결과를 생성할 수 있습니다.
보고에서는 이 광고 제목 추적 필드로 성과를 분석할 수 있습니다.
옵션 2: 오퍼 수준에서 전달
이제, 이 모든 것이 오퍼 소스/오퍼에 의해 구성된 데이터 전달이므로, 대신 오퍼 수준에서 하드코딩하도록 선택할 수 있습니다.
따라서 오퍼를 생성하고, System1을 오퍼 소스로 선택한 다음, 데이터 전달로 가서 사용자 정의 문자열 옵션을 사용하여 compkey 또는 rskey 필드에 대한 오퍼 수준 재정의를 추가할 수 있습니다.
이렇게 하면 다른 키워드에 대해 여러 오퍼를 생성하고 이를 퍼널에서 다른 오퍼처럼 회전시킬 수 있습니다.
이제 값들은 트래픽 소스의 광고에 의존하지 않고 FunnelFlux 내에서 제어됩니다:
이제 보고에서 키워드를 다른 오퍼로 분리할 수 있습니다.
이 방법의 장점은 FunnelFlux 내에서 더 많은 제어가 가능하고 언제든지 이를 변경하거나 광고를 건드리지 않고 회전에서 페이지를 추가/제거할 수 있다는 것입니다.
단점은 오퍼를 생성하고 퍼널을 구성하는 데 더 많은 수동 작업이 필요하며, 광고와 검색 중재 페이지 간의 일치성이 부족할 수 있다는 것입니다.
또한 규정 준수와 광고 제목이 있는 소스의 경우 검색 중재 파트너가 사용자에게 표시된 광고와 일치하지 않을 수 있는 다양한 키워드를 전달하는 것을 허용하는지 고려해야 합니다.
초기 CTR 추적하기
이 부분은 선택사항입니다.
원한다면 초기 검색 중재 페이지의 CTR을 추적해볼 수 있습니다. 이를 원하지 않는다면 System1 오퍼 소스에서 search_track_url 매개변수를 삭제할 수 있습니다.
따라서 퍼널에서 다음과 같이 트래픽 노드 --> 오퍼 노드(System1 오퍼) --> 더미 랜더를 가질 수 있습니다:
이의 목적은 단지 액션을 생성하여 오퍼 페이지에서 실제로 클릭이 발생할 수 있게 하는 것입니다 -- 그렇지 않으면 클릭스루를 트리거할 방법이 없습니다.
더미 랜더는 무엇이든 될 수 있지만, "Dummy CTR Page"와 같은 새 페이지를 만들고 URL을 https://mylanderdomain.com/non-existent-page와 같이 설정하는 것을 제안합니다.
페이지 자체는 브라우저에 로드되지 않지만 System1의 서버가 리디렉션 체인을 따라갈 경우 google.com이나 test.com과 같은 실제 웹사이트에 많은 무작위 서버 사이드 URL 요청을 스팸으로 보내지 않기를 원합니다.
이제 사용자가 광고 > FunnelFlux URL > System1 오퍼 페이지로 이동하면 일반적으로 클릭할 수 있는 다양한 버튼이 표시됩니다. 클릭 시, FunnelFlux에 액션 이벤트를 발생시켜 클릭스루를 추적합니다. 다음 페이지에서 무언가를 클릭하면 전환을 보냅니다.
이를 통해 초기 페이지의 CTR에 대한 통찰을 얻을 수 있으며, 이는 앵글/일치성을 이해하는 데 중요할 수 있습니다.
이 데이터를 정말로 원하는 경우에만 이를 권장합니다. 그렇지 않으면 피할 수 있는 추가 단계/복잡성이 있기 때문입니다.